Marketing Consultancy

Marketing consultancy often becomes a necessity for companies that need to develop, grow or improve profit. The fact that business owners have to turn to professionals for assistance is logical since a random evolution of a company sends a bad message, brings lower profit rates and hinders the creation of solid relationships with the clients. What does marketing consultancy involve? Well, on the basis of an agreement that a client signs with such a service provider, the consultants will work in the direction of making your business more successful from all points of view. The companies that start from scratch will usually need a business plan, but its implementation is only possible once the business owner agrees to it.

Market visibility, competition studies, advertising campaigns, online promotions, statistics and many others, represent the basic services related to marketing consultancy. There are two theoretical and practical trends that separate consultants in two groups: a traditional line and a modern one. Traditional marketing consultancy brings an analytical view of the market, which eventually leads to a disciplined and linear development based on the identification of the business opportunities. On the other hand, the modern marketing approach, focuses more on market awareness and brand creation.

Both types of marketing consultancy work well for financial growth, yet the present day tendency is to develop, adjust, reinvent so that the companies become capable of facing the tough realities of an ever-changing market that resembles too much to a jungle. Nobody should minimize the importance and the complexity of marketing consultancy, particularly since good business results are the outcome of a combined work of several departments belonging to a marketing agency. When you first contract the services of a professional marketing company, they will do their homework and learn everything they can on your company and the business sector it serves.

Once everything is clear, the marketing consultancy experts get to work and design plans and programs meant to increase the business exposure on the market and thus boost up sales. The ROI (return on investment) increase is the best indicator that the implementation of new marketing tactics works positively. Advertising is one other service worth mentioning as part of any business promotion, since it wins new customers in a variety of ways. Whether conducted online or by traditional informational media, marketing consultancy and advertising should make a difference to the evolution of any business towards more and more achievements.

Email Software Reviews

Business owners are fully aware of how important marketing software is for the online success of their campaigns, but the difficult thing is the proper choice of a good tool or program to help in the process. Email software reviews could be a very good source of information but before trusting any such product description, let us consider the criteria that allow evaluation in the first place.

Email software reviews should analyze features with all the advantages and disadvantages they bring. By any feature set, we normally refer to the combination of technical functions that contribute to the creation and development of viable, professional email marketing campaigns. Once features have been described in detail, setup follows next in terms of importance.

The details concerning the ease of installation represent an important part of email marketing reviews. Any quality software includes clear installation instructions so that the setup of the program may be performed without any difficulty and without the need of technical training. Any user, regardless of the computer knowledge level should be able to use an email software properly.

User friendly design is one other important aspect that email software reviews deal with. And here descriptions ought to refer to how comprehensive the interface is and how easy and comfortable the navigation. Any computer or Internet newbie should be able to use the program with a maximum of efficiency. This is in fact what user-friendly refers to in the first place.

The email generation and the reporting features make other important elements included in email software reviews. The professionalism and efficiency in email generation even for bulk purposes as well as the possibility of getting activity reports and statistics represent aspects that differentiate quality tools from less valuable ones. With a good email software you should be able to track the number of unsubscribers, the number of viewed emails as well as the amount of clicks generated by the emails.

To conclude, when you want to purchase a software program to assist you with the email marketing campaigns, search for email software reviews that analyze features, ease of setup, email design and reporting options. These criteria apply to registration-based products, since the free versions are limited in terms of functions and features.

Check at least four of five such reviews before you identify one that corresponds to your business needs and profit expectations. The price should not be neglected either, but it is definitely not a conclusive criterion of appreciation.

Marketing Strategy Consulting

Small and large businesses alike are subject to very serious challenges when it comes to marketing strategy consulting. The sudden or abrupt market evolution and events, the specificity of every business sector as well as the overall social conditions, influence the way companies promote their products and services. Harsh times like this financial crisis that struck the world in 2008, and still holds a firm grip on the world economy, determine major changes in advertising, promotional campaigns, as well as a redefining of long and short term goals. Therefore, now more than ever, marketing strategy consulting has become a must and the key to financial survival.

All the objective and subjective as well as stable and variable factors are taken into consideration and put through serious analysis before a change of paradigm is performed. In order for marketing strategy consulting experts to come up with viable suggestions, all the elements of the equation have to be known. Thus, starting from the definition of the targeted market segment to the advertising of the products based on this targeting, all the processes have to be correct and appropriate in order to ensure a good return on investment. Costs and profit estimates are also determined thanks to the monitoring of the market evolution.

What marketing strategy consulting generates initially is prediction. To put it in more simple words: you’ve got the product, you want to sell it, you have to determine who will be interested in it and who will have the money to make the purchase, and then you should make sure that your message gets heard and convinces the potential client. Besides these major lines of action, there are some variables that slightly modify the course of action or the evolution of marketing campaigns. Normally, there are all sorts of external factors both social and economic that cannot be predicted or which even if predicted will have a negative impact for business.

Therefore, marketing strategy consulting makes an almost compulsory stage in the evolution of a company on the market, particularly since competition is tough, people have a lower purchase capacity because of the money shortage and the unemployment. Consequently, before making an investment and operating some changes in the way you conduct your business, it is advisable to get some marketing strategy consulting and see how your plan may affect the overall course of the company. If all the indicators point into a favorable direction, then, feel free to carry on, if not, try to reassess the business condition and be cautious!

Search Engine Marketing Services

There are lots of websites and companies specialized in delivering search engine marketing services. You can resort to them in order to ensure the success of your own business. Most such companies that activate online offer expertise in search engine marketing. They include complete portfolios of industry-leading search marketing solutions that you can choose from. Among the search engine marketing services that other experts can provide in the field there are search engine optimization (SEO) including keyword market intelligence, meta-data optimization/titles and meta-tags, keyword optimization campaigns, publishing best practices integration (BPI), XML trusted feed, website architecture analysis, practices integration and pay-for-placement (P4P).

Other search engine marketing services you can benefit from when you decide to work with such specialists are keyword research, SEO for individual pages, visual and non-visual website inspection and consultation, search engine submissions, top page ranking placements, link exchange, stats package and traffic analyzer reports as well some extra services including monthly maintenance, pay per click search engines, mini sites and manual submission to 300 lower tier search engines/directories.

One of the most important search engine marketing services is represented by search engine optimization. In order to optimize, so to say, a website it is necessary to build it in such a way that it will be easily discovered by search engines. It is also crucial to design each page in a way that the content of the site can be thoroughly mapped and indexed to keywords that the potential customers and users will employ in order to look for whatever services or products you have to sell. These optimization services are based on key objectives using all appropriate techniques that are available to professionals search engine marketers. The methodologies used are usually designed to go from the identification of the steps necessary to quickly and effectively accomplish the job at hand, to planning and finally implementing the plan so as to achieve the desired effects within a time frame as short as possible.

Another of the most important search engine marketing services is the keyword market intelligence service. This is so important as your keywords are actually your life; your keyword market is, let?s say, the search language that the potential customers use in order to try to find you as a business online. Therefore if you fail to understand your online keyword market well enough and begin using it inappropriately, then you will have a problem in communicating and doing business directly with both current and new customers.

Search Engine Marketing Software

Search engine marketing software is needed by web site owners and managers in order to index the information on their site so that searchers will more easily and faster find what they are looking for. Without having the proper search engine marketing software solution installed, there are fewer chances that the site will be ranked high in the list of results by search engines. Being at the top of that list guarantees visitor traffic on one?s web site which may eventually increase the amount of transactions.

Generally speaking it is not easy to choose from the various search engine marketing software solutions and packages offered on the Internet. In case help is needed, it is pretty wise to check on forums and to talk to specialists that know exactly what that particular software does for your site and whether it is the one you actually need for your business requirements. Moreover, there are many sites that offer these types of search engine marketing software solutions and they have also posted articles which present information on how to perform the selection of such software.

Plus, there are also reviews on the software to be bought, and such informative materials can be written either by specialists, that is, reviewers paid to write about the programs, or by those who have already bought, installed and used the programs. Sometimes it is better to read the reviews and comments made by users and not only by professional reviewers because they are the ones to give you a true feedback on what the search engine marketing software really does and how it does it. Paid reviewers may sometimes be less true to reality.

Various types of search engine marketing software solutions are also used by online marketing companies who provide search engine optimization, pay per click services, web analytics, feed management and many more in order to make sure that the client web sites increase the quality and the amount of visitor traffic. The solutions that they use and recommend to site owners are sometimes the best options that the owner can make in order to enhance results in the business line.

The simple or complex package of search engine marketing solutions that you choose can actually reduce the cost of Internet marketing and can make the most of your return on investment, also called ROI. The technology you choose to rely on can make all the difference in the world for your site marketing campaign. Therefore, a search engine marketing software would be a more than useful investment.

Search Engine Marketing Tools

Search engine marketing tools represent the key factors that often distinguish between good and bad online business, not to mention the fact that they make you visible or invisible on the electronic market. Why is it so important to be visible? Well very many people turn to the Internet to get help in finding information, services or products they want to lay hands on. That, if no other is the reason why search engine marketing tools are essential to you today?s online marketer.

As competition is the keyword in today?s commerce you must do your best if you want real success to be part of your life. There are three major goals to focus on: visibility, presence and traffic. Visibility refers to being easily accessible to the search engine; presence aims at continually improving your website exposure; traffic has as goal your getting more qualified, convertible visitors to your website. You need to work on these three aims in a very effective, efficient and productive way and yet maintain yourself within the boundaries of high quality and good content. For the purpose you can resort to the services provided by specialized firms.

The problem of cost is definitely a sore issue, especially when you’ve just started your business, on a tight budget. There is not better time than this to be careful about what to choose in terms of search engine marketing tools and providing firms.

When talking about search engine marketing tools what should you actually think of? The major part of a typical SEO workflow comprises routine tasks that are repetitive operations that do not require critical thinking or analysis on your part. Anyway, it is better if they are performed by software than people. As doing these tasks by hand is time consuming, leaving you only little time for actually optimizing your website, you can have them done fully or partially automatical using some search engine marketing tools for keyword research, rank tracking, and link building.

Although you cannot leave the tools to do all the keyword research for you, you can at least trust them with delivering search statistics and keyword suggestions. The tools also give you extra keyword tips, beside those you have thought about, which represent additional keywords that you might find useful in your optimization process. As for rank tracking, you can fully rely on the search engine marketing tools and be sure the job will be done perfectly well.

Computer Programming Career

Building a computer programming career is not an easy task. It requires a solid educational background and a committed engagement with programming technology used. Let’s explore some of the facts related to computer programming career at the present.

First of all, it is the formal education which helps someone to lay the foundation for a good computer programming career. The first degree usually introduces the concepts of computer science and related technologies. When it comes to programmers, not all the programmers hold a first degree in computer science or information technology. There are so many programmers with the first degrees from other disciplines such as electrical engineering, physical science etc.

Choosing the right technology is one of the decisions that one has to make when progressing in computer programming career. Usually, programmers can’t be jack of all trades. There are a number of technologies and programming languages. If you want to build a successful computer programming career, then you have to select a set of technologies and programming languages to learn and work on. Selecting all is not a possibility as it is too much for someone to handle. As an example, one can select Java or .NET technologies when taking this important decision.

Training and practice is essential when it comes to building a successful computer programming career. Of course the concepts help a lot to understand how computer programming works, but the real ‘meat’ is with the hands-on program writing. Although the concepts are useful when writing massive enterprise business solutions, it is the experience and training that count when implementing complex business problems. Therefore, one needs to practice what he/she knows and renew the knowledge.

The nature of the employer does play a vital role when it comes to the progress of your computer programming career. There are two types of employers when it comes to the technology; one which is inspired by technology and has a balance between business and technology, and one which totally focus on the business aspects. Although the second category of employers may produce the most of the profit, it can be a disaster when it comes to computer programming career as they do not provide enough technical challenge for the programmers.

Last, but not least, the attitude of the programmers is one of the main factors for success or the failure in their computer programming career. People with a negative attitude are very likely to fail in there computer programming career as computer industry is not a place for laid back type of people.

Computer Science Programming

Computer science programming is often called ‘programming’ or ‘coding’ as they easier to use. Usually computer science programming involves in writing, modifying, fixing, and maintaining the source code of a computer software program. Since the software source code is written in a computer science programming languages, the programmer or ‘coder’ needs to know the programming language in depth. The objective of computer science programming is to have a piece of software that helps to perform some activity.

In the conventional software development life cycle, computer science programming phase is considered as one of the most important steps. Although there are ongoing debates on whether the computer science programming is an art or engineering practice, I personally believe that computer science programming is an engineering exercise. This is basically due to that fact that there is a lot of logic being used in the subject.

When it comes to the history of ‘programming’ it has had a different form. First of all, it was all mechanically predefined procedure that was introduced as programming. One of the most famous ‘programming’ incident was Al-Jazari’s robotic musicians who were programmed using pegs and cams. Although this type of ‘programming’ take a different path from the modern computer science programming, there is a positive influence from the history to modern era of programming.

There are a few requirements in the modern computer science programming. Although quality requirements were not important when computer science programming was first introduced, quality has become one of the key factors in modern programming practices. When it comes to quality, efficiency, performance, reliability, robustness, usability, and portability are considered as the critical factors. If any source code misses any of these characteristics, then that piece of code is not considered as a quality code.
For making the programmer’s life easy, there are many algorithms introduced and standardized. These algorithms can be reused for addressing many problems in the field of computer science programming. In addition to that, there are a number of methodologies introduced for making the computer science programming practice easy. There are four computer programming langue categories based on the methodologies; procedural (or structured), functional, and logical. Based on the methodology, these programming languages are ideal for software development in deferent domains.

When it comes to computer science programming languages, almost all the languages follow a simple set of guidelines; input, output, the calculations, conditional executions, and repetition. For writing a successful computer software, a programmer needs to understand and employ the above guidelines in such way that they comply with the architecture they are working on.

Video Production

Video production is concerned mostly with non-broadcast program making and is generally distributed through DVDs or online. These types of productions are usually made on low budgets, which does not mean they are not seen by many people. On the contrary, millions of people watch them daily, as it is the case with the productions cast on Youtube. Due to the amazing advances in technology, the differences between video production and television production are becoming more and more limited and unclear. Besides the type of budget and the size of the production team, which is obviously bigger in the case of television, one significant difference lies in that TV production gets broadcast to large numbers of people, by satellite or cable transmission, either live or recorded. TV transmissions are required to follow strictly controlled technical standards. Yet, TV productions may be considered a type of video production once they have been distributed through a non-broadcast method as the ones mentioned above.

Although video production seems little complex, due to the way the equipment has been designed for quick easy use, yet there might be a problem in actually doing it. The problem usually occurs because of the human factor in case there is no or little talent, passion and commitment to it. The video camera gives us, the users, an immediate picture of the scene in front of us and the microphone picks up the sound of the action on the spot. Most of the users just point the video camera and microphone at the subject and start recording but the result is often dissatisfying. Thus, no matter how easy it may seem, video production involves a few know-how principles beside the producer?s talent of choosing the right subject and the right lighting effects. It is important that you know how to handle the equipment and the effects of its various controls and functions properly, how to use the equipment effectively ? developing the skills required for good camerawork and sound production, convey ideas and emotions convincingly ? using the medium persuasively, as well as organize it systematically ? using practical planning, preparation, and production.

If we discuss video production from the professional perspective, we can say it is both an art and a service meant to videotape, edit and distribute a finished video product. It can include television production, corporate and event videos and commercial video production. Corporate video production covers a wide variety of purposes, from corporate communication, training and education to recording conferences and conventions, sales or other events. Video production can also be used at different events whether they are for school, sporting, wedding, and church.

Search Engine Marketing Strategy

Internet marketing has become more and more of a complex and looked for service nowadays precisely because competition has been upped by the huge number of consultants that are out there fishing for clients. The way that they manage to attract new customers may have a bit to do with the search engine marketing strategy that they use. The success that they register with one client is quick to bring along a new client that has heard about the good results their competitor has achieved through the services offered by the same Internet marketing provider.

To start, we cannot say that there is one best search engine marketing strategy that brings about the promised and long desired success. Good consultants rely on a wide variety of techniques and strategies in order to promote the products and services that their client offers to the public and they associate forward thinking and ingenuity in trying to have the business they promote online, rank among the top ones on a directory or a search engine.

If one consultant needs to improve the search engine marketing strategy, one thing he/she can do is search the Internet for forums and specialized sites that come up with tips and offer suggestions on how to achieve better results which in their turn increase the number of clients. There are tutorials that one can lay their hands on either for free or in exchange for a certain amount of money that he or she will discover to be a good investment later. One can find tutorials that are completely free to reproduce, however there is a request on the part of the one posting it to read the copyright statement and to respect it.

Without having the basics presented in such tutorials and without mastering them, there is no point in accessing and registering on forums that come up with tips sounding extremely complicated in order to improve the search engine marketing strategy. First of all, the consultant needs to have quite a good grasp of the subject presented in tutorials and only after that can he/she dare to follow more complicated techniques and assume risks posed by associating.

All in all, the search engine marketing strategy that is desired in order to gain success and rank among the best consultants on the market consists of constantly communicating with your client, combining and employing the most achieving search engine optimization techniques and heavily relying on pay per click advertising. When all these are combined, and when you associate other techniques such as email advertising you are most likely to come up with a really good search engine marketing strategy.